Landscaping Proposal Templates: A Practical Structure You Can Reuse

A proposal does not need to be long to be effective. It needs clear scope, clean pricing, realistic timeline milestones, and a simple path to approval. This guide gives you a format your team can use on every project without rebuilding from scratch.

What strong proposals do well

Strong proposals reduce back-and-forth because clients can quickly understand what is included, what it costs, and what happens after approval. That clarity improves project handoff from sales to production.

  • Scope is written in plain language with no hidden assumptions.
  • Pricing is itemized in a format clients can compare and approve.
  • Timeline and payment terms are visible before signature.

The reusable proposal structure

1) Scope that removes confusion

  • Start with a one-paragraph project summary in plain language.
  • Break deliverables into work items with units and short descriptions.
  • Add a dedicated exclusions block so clients know what is outside the proposal.

2) Pricing clients can review quickly

  • Use line items that match the scope categories.
  • Separate required work from optional upgrades.
  • Show payment schedule directly under the total to avoid follow-up confusion.

3) Timeline with milestones

  • Use phase names instead of only date ranges.
  • List key activities per phase so progress is easy to track.
  • Call out assumptions that can shift timing such as permitting or material lead times.

Common mistakes to remove

  • Combining scope and pricing into one dense paragraph.
  • Skipping exclusions and creating ambiguity later.
  • Using one total number without line-item context.
  • Sending proposals without a clear decision deadline.

Pre-send checklist

  • Proposal validity date is included.
  • All placeholders are replaced before export.
  • Client name, address, and email are correct.
  • Scope, pricing, and payment schedule match.
  • Signature block is present on the last page.
